PULASKI, Tenn. – The UT Southern men's basketball team continued its hot start to the season Tuesday night, defeating Welch College 98–67 at the Curry Athletic Complex. The Firehawks were dominant from start to finish, shooting over 50% from the floor and showcasing a balanced attack that featured five players in double figures.
The Firehawks caught fire early as Mike Bell, Jr. opened with back-to-back threes before De'Marreon Baldwin threw down a fast-break dunk to ignite the crowd. UT Southern's full-court pressure forced multiple turnovers, leading to an 18–5 lead just six minutes into the game. Bell stayed dialed in from deep, hitting another triple to extend the margin, while Baldwin scored through contact to make it 25–8 midway through the first half.
Luke Lentz and Khadir Muhammad came off the bench and added instant offense — Lentz hit a pair of threes, and Muhammad drilled two more from beyond the arc in the closing minutes of the period. Jack Harper added a three of his own before the buzzer as the Firehawks rolled into halftime leading 54–26.
In the second half, UT Southern kept the pressure on both ends. Baldwin finished back-to-back drives at the rim, and Antonio Cochran connected from long range to stretch the lead to 30. Harper caught fire late, hitting three consecutive three-pointers to push the margin to 90–58 before the reserves closed out the final minutes.
Bell Jr. led all scorers with 23 points on 9-of-13 shooting, including 4-of-6 from three, and grabbed seven rebounds. Baldwin was right behind with 18 points, seven rebounds, and three assists, while Harper poured in a career high 20 points on 6-of-9 from deep off the bench. Muhammad added 10 points and four assists, and Lentz chipped in six points with two steals. Cochran filled the stat sheet with five points, six rebounds, and five assists, while Reyes contributed three points and a rebound.
UT Southern shot 52.2% from the floor, 45.7% (16-of-35) from three, and outrebounded Welch 45–25. The Firehawks tallied 25 assists on 36 made baskets and scored 48 points in the paint while holding Welch to just 35.5% shooting overall.
